WebDec 8, 2015 · Smelting is the process of heating ore, or rock containing metal, to such high temperatures that the metal is melted and separated from the minerals in the rock. A blast furnace, initially fueled by charcoal, provided heat. Both iron and copper were smelted in Michigan, at lakeside locations convenient for shipping the metal to other localities. Smelting is a process of applying heat to an ore, to extract a base metal. It is a form of extractive metallurgy. It is used to extract many metals from their ores, including silver, iron, copper, and other base metals. WebThe blast furnace requires a sinter plant in order to prepare the iron ore for reduction. [2] Unlike the blast furnace, smelting reduction processes are typical smaller and use coal and oxygen directly to reduce iron ore into a usable product. Smelting reduction processes come in two basic varieties, two-stage or single-stage. WebAt smelting temperatures of the order of 1973–2073 K, these alloys are extremely fluid and it is important to ensure a “liquid tight” bottom. Furnaces used for the smelting of high-silicon alloys, i.e., over 70% Si, are mostly of the open-top type, and the carbon monoxide generated is burnt on the top of the furnace.
